  In recent years, cases of sexual harassment involving foreign nationals in Korea have been on the rise.   Many assume that once the criminal process concludes, the matter is resolved. In reality, immigration proceedings often begin after the court’s judgment is finalized.   When a foreign resident is charged or convicted of sexual harassment or other sexual offenses, they may still face immigration review even after the criminal case has ended. Depending on the outcome, this could result in visa cancellation or an order to leave Korea. A single incident can have serious consequences for one’s ability to remain in the country.   This issue is particularly important for those who live with their families or work in Korea under an employment visa. Simply paying a fine does not guarantee the matter is over — immigration authorities often make separate, independent decisions from the criminal court.   For anyone in such a situation, seeking Korean attorney consultation at an early stage is essential. Why Korean Attorney consultation is necessary

  If a foreign national is fined for a sex crime in Korea, the case can have immediate immigration consequences.   Importantly, even if a foreigner receives a not-guilty verdict or a suspension of indictment in a sexual harassment case, immigration authorities may still conduct their own review and assess whether the person remains eligible to stay in Korea.   Because sex crime allegations are treated with particular seriousness in Korean society, visa cancellation or deportation may occur regardless of the criminal court’s decision.   Additionally, such cases often involve complex evidence—including witness statements, video recordings, and medical reports—requiring careful legal review. For foreign nationals, language barriers, cultural misunderstandings, and visa-related concerns can make the process even more challenging.   That’s why it is crucial to approach these cases with a strategy that considers both criminal defense and immigration impact. Why Korean Attorney consultation is needed for immigration after criminal procedure

  Sex crime cases involving foreign nationals in Korea can lead to serious consequences even after the court has issued a verdict. Immigration authorities often conduct a separate assessment of the individual’s visa eligibility and may decide to revoke the visa or initiate deportation procedures based on their findings.   For this reason, it is not sufficient to concentrate only on the criminal trial. A dual-response approach—addressing both criminal defense and immigration implications—is essential from the start to minimize potential risks.   When a foreign national is under investigation for sexual harassment, obtaining an early Korean attorney consultation is vital. An experienced defense lawyer who regularly assists foreigners can help clarify the client’s position, avoid self-incriminating statements, and build a strategy to mitigate possible penalties.   In addition, an attorney well-versed in immigration law can help prepare for the criminal background review, compile supporting documentation to protect visa status, and, if necessary, request a departure deferral or pursue other administrative remedies.   Because criminal and immigration issues are deeply connected in these cases, timely Korean attorney consultation ensures a comprehensive defense.
